According to a 2016 study in the Annals of Internal Medicine, physicians spent just 27 percent of an average day or shift with patients, while nearly 50 percent of their day was spent on electronic health records and other "desk work." This imbalance can wear on physicians who desire to spend more time in direct patient care.
